Email Relevance A Global Concern
In a recent Emarketer missive, it was revealed that consumers are expanding the definition of what they consider spam. In fact, more than 25% of consumers in Asia-Pacific believe promotional e-mail or newsletters that were opt-in—but no longer engage them or address their needs—are spam, according to the Epsilon/Return Path [...]

Email Open Rates at 22%
Per MarketingSherpa, the open rate for email is not what it seems. In fact, the stalwart of email marketing metrics is flawed because image blocking reduces the ability to measure an open rate. So, it's limited in its usefulness for email marketers. This is why email marketers should think twice [...]
